What is a Value Proposition?

In business, a value proposition is a statement of what your company provides to your customer. It is a sentence or two that explains why customers should choose your product or service—and how it can benefit them.

A good business value proposition will help you attract new customers and keep current ones happy. It should also make your product or service more affordable and valuable than your rivals.

Why is a Value Proposition Important?

A value proposition is the cornerstone of a successful business. It’s what separates a good company from a great one. It must answer the question “What’s in it for me?” and convince customers to switch from their current provider to your company.

The key to creating a solid value proposition is to focus on your customer’s needs and wants. You must understand your customer’s frustrations and address them head-on in your value proposition. You also need to be honest with your customers about their challenges and how you plan to help them overcome them. Finally, make sure that the value you offer is relevant to the customer’s individual situation.

How to Write a Business Value Proposition

There are several things to consider when writing your value proposition. First, make sure it’s clear and concise. Second, make sure it resonates with your target audience. Finally, it should be credible and sustainable.

Here are some tips to help you write a great value proposition:

1) Define your target market carefully. You need to know who you’re selling to before you can create a compelling value proposition for them. This will help you focus on your target market’s specific needs and wants and ensure that your offer matches those needs perfectly.

2) Be specific about your product or service’s features and benefits. Don’t generalize about how great everything will be or how everyone can benefit from using your product or service – be specific about what makes yours unique, valuable, and appealing.

5 Steps to Crafting a Value Proposition That Delivers on Your Business Goals

1. Define your target market and what they want.

2. Understand their needs and how you can meet them.

3. Brainstorm possible solutions to your target market’s problems.

4. test potential solutions with potential customers to see how well they respond.

5. optimize your solution based on customer feedback

In Summary

Having a clear, concise value proposition is essential to your marketing strategy. You must know how to convey to your customers how your product or service will help make their lives better. Therefore, a well-defined value proposition is essential to your core content marketing strategy.
